Our Collaborators

Tarana Burke is the Founder of the “me too” movement and co-host of a Town Hall with A Long Walk Home’s Girl/Friends leaders at the School of the Art Institute of Chicago.

 

Eve Ewing is a renowned poet and University of Chicago sociologist who offered comic book workshops to A Long Walk Home’s Girl/Friends.

 

Tatyana Fazlalizadeh is a prolific public artist who collaborated with A Long Walk Home’s Girl/Friends as a part of her Stop Making Women Smile project.

 

Dream Hampton is the noted filmmaker of Emmy-nominated Surviving R. Kelly series and strategic consultant for A Long Walk Home’s leadership team.

 

John Legend is an EGOT winning singer, songwriter, philanthropist and one of the earliest supporters of A Long Walk Home with his Show Me foundation.

 

Jada Pinkett Smith is a celebrated actress who supports A Long Walk Home by wearing our “Got Consent” shirt on red carpets and in media appearances.  

 

Gloria Steinem is a feminist icon, active fundraiser, and strategic advisor for A Long Walk Home.

 

Jamila Woods is a beloved Chicago musician who collaborated with A Long Walk Home for our Black Girl Takeover project and the Rekia Boyd Memorial Project. She has also led writing workshops with the young leaders.
